Safeguarding podcast – Tools for Today’s Digital Parents with Stephen Balkam CEO FOSI

In this Safeguarding Podcast with Stephen Balkam CEO FOSI we discuss their report “Tools for Today’s Digital Parents” to keep their children safe online. We cover “resilience”, Age Verification, Parental Controls vs “SafetyTech”, the different attitudes towards and practices of online child safety by Millennial, Gen-X and Boomer parents, the six key takeaways from FOSI’s report
